Latex gloves, sometimes called rubber gloves, have been a staple for many years to protect hands in a variety of situations, but for many people they can do more harm than good. If you’ve ever taken off a pair of latex gloves to find yourself with a hand rash, you might be one of the many folks out there who either have a latex allergy or sensitivity to latex proteins. The good news is that there are a ton of options out there that can keep your hands safe without triggering a reaction, and we just so happen to be experts on the best ones.
